Trouble In Paradise

Jimmy Buffett’s Margaritaville Casino and Restaurant in Biloxi, Miss., isn’t having the best of luck.

The casino is being sued by Landry’s Golden Nugget, owner of the Isle Casino Biloxi, over a non-compete agreement. Doug Shipley, former GM of Isle Casino Biloxi, is now with Margaritaville, and is accused of breaking his employment agreement by stealing confidential information.

Meanwhile, Margaritaville was fined $10,000 for not having enough money on hand to pay its patrons and its bills.

Stacey McKay, former marketing director at the Isle, is also alleged to have stolen information from the casino when she followed Shipley to Margaritaville.

“The accusations are groundless,” Michael Cavanaugh, attorney for Margaritaville, told Sun-Herald. He said the lawsuit was brought because the new owners were disappointed that Shipley did not want to stay at the Isle.

Judge Roger Clark has appointed a computer expert to determine if Isle data is on Margaritaville’s computers.
